MRS. WARFIELD'S COIFFURE

(Received May 27, 1 p.m.)

MONTS,' May 26.

"This is the best laugh of all," said Mrs Warfield when she was shown a report that she was having her hair dyed blue to match her wedding dress. She added that she'had not changed the style of doing her hair for two years.
